Hei!
Olen harjoitellut nettisivun ja tietokannan yhteyden tekemistä ja se on onnistunut.
Eli siis nettisivuillani kirjoitettu teksti tallentuu Access-tietokantaan ASP-tekniikan avulla. Nyt olisin kiinnostunut tietämään miten muuten voisin lukea tietoja kuin menemällä tietokantaan?
Asp ja tietokannat
4
1194
Vastaukset
- it-duunari
Mitä tarkoitat tällä "miten muuten voisin lukea tietoja ..."? Haluatko lukea kantaan talletettua tietoa vai kenties jotain tekstitiedostoa?
Tavallisten tiedostojen käsittely onnistuu FileSystemObject:lla:
Set foo = Server.CreateObject("Scripting.FileSystemObject)
Jos taas haluat jotain tietokannan ja tekstitiedoston väliltä, niin käytä XML:llää
Set foo = Server.CreateObject("Msxml2.DOMDocument.4.0")
Ohjeita löytyy osoitteista:
http://www.microsoft.com/scripting
http://www.microsoft.com/xml- Minna
Siis haluan lukea sitä tietokantaan syötettyä tietoa esim. tilauksia jne. suoraan netti- tms. sivulta ilman että tarvii mennä tietokantaan tietoja lukemaan.
- it-duunari
Minna kirjoitti:
Siis haluan lukea sitä tietokantaan syötettyä tietoa esim. tilauksia jne. suoraan netti- tms. sivulta ilman että tarvii mennä tietokantaan tietoja lukemaan.
Jälleen tarvitaan tarkennuksia. Mitä tarkoitat tällä "ilman että tarvii mennä tietokantaan tietoja lukemaan"? Tarkoitatko tietokannan avaamista jollain ohjelmalla (esim. Access) vai jotain muuta, mitä?
Tietokannassa olevia tietoja voi kyllä lukea ohjelmallisesti, eli asp-sivun koodista käsin, mutta minun ajatusmaailmassani se on juuri tuota "tietokantaan menemistä". Kun kyseessä on asp-sivu, muita vaihtoehtoja ei edes ole.
Käytännössä tietokannan lukeminen sql-kyselyä käyttäen tapahtuu suurin piirtein näin (en ole tarkastanut koodin toimivuutta mitenkään):
Tietokantasivu
- Minna
it-duunari kirjoitti:
Jälleen tarvitaan tarkennuksia. Mitä tarkoitat tällä "ilman että tarvii mennä tietokantaan tietoja lukemaan"? Tarkoitatko tietokannan avaamista jollain ohjelmalla (esim. Access) vai jotain muuta, mitä?
Tietokannassa olevia tietoja voi kyllä lukea ohjelmallisesti, eli asp-sivun koodista käsin, mutta minun ajatusmaailmassani se on juuri tuota "tietokantaan menemistä". Kun kyseessä on asp-sivu, muita vaihtoehtoja ei edes ole.
Käytännössä tietokannan lukeminen sql-kyselyä käyttäen tapahtuu suurin piirtein näin (en ole tarkastanut koodin toimivuutta mitenkään):
Tietokantasivu
Hei!
Juuri tuota tarkoitin siis haluan lukea tietokannan tietoja Internetissä ilman, että tarvii avata tietokantaa Accessilla. ("ilman että tarvii mennä tietokantaan lukemaan tietoja").
Ok huonosti selitetty.
Kiitos paljon avustasi! Kokeilen tuota antamaasi koodia.
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
- 1797443
Klaukkalan onnettomuus 4.4
Klaukkalassa oli tänään se kolmen nuoren naisen onnettomuus, onko kellään mitään tietoa mitä kävi tai ketä onnettomuudes873306- 572335
Kolari Klaukkala
Kaksi teinityttö kuoli. Vastaantulijoille ei käynyt mitenkään. Mikä auto ja malli telineillä oli entä se toinen auto? Se691502Ukraina ja Zelenskyn ylläpitämä sota tuhoaa Euroopan, ei Venäjä
Mutta tätä ei YLE eikä Helsingin Sanomat kerto.3701438- 571353
Ooo! Kaija Koo saa kesämökille öky-rempan:jättimäinen terde, poreallas... Katso ennen-jälkeen kuvat!
Wow, nyt on Kaija Koon mökkipihalla kyllä iso muutos! Miltä näyttää, haluaisitko omalle mökillesi vaikkapa samanlaisen l201326Toivoisin, että lähentyisit kanssani
Tänään koin, että välillämme oli enemmän. Kummatkin katsoivat pidempään kuin tavallisesti toista silmiin. En tiedä mistä171071Olisinpa jo siellä, otatkohan minut vastaan
Olisitpa lähelläni ja antaisit minun maalata sinulle kuvaa siitä kaikesta ikävästä, tuskasta, epävarmuudesta ja mieleni791030Kevyt on olo
Tiedättekö, että olo kevenee kummasti, kun päästää turhista asioista tai ihmisistä irti! Tämä on hyvä näin <3841028